Surgical resection is the treatment of choice for canine adrenal pheochromocytomas (PHEOs). Information on en bloc resection of adrenal PHEO with tumour thrombus, right hepatic division and segmental caudal vena cava (CVC) running through the adrenal tumour and right hepatic division is limited.

WebDuration of anesthesia and surgery, percentage of dogs with pheochromocytoma involving the right versus left adrenal gland, size of tumor, and presence of vascular invasion were similar for PBZ-treated and untreated dogs. Thirty-three (69%) of 48 dogs survived adrenalectomy in the perioperative period. Webwith metastasis to C4 in 1 dog and neurologic signs associ- ated with metastasis to the spinal canal in 1 dog). Pheochromocytoma was diagnosed as an incidental find- ing in 35 of 61 dogs (57%).
